Polysulfones terminated with trimethylsilylethynyl, ethynyl, and phenylethynyl groups increased solvent resistance. Upon application of heat, with or without catalyst, end groups react to provide cross linking and chain extension. Result: temperature of polymer increased, more importantly, solvent resistance greatly improved. Solutions used conveniently for preparation of films, coatings, membranes, prepreg, and adhesive tapes.
